On April 24, 2025, Kearny Financial Corp. announced its third-quarter fiscal 2025 results, reporting a net income of $6.6 million, or $0.11 per diluted share, consistent with the previous quarter. The company also declared a quarterly cash dividend of $0.11 per share, payable on May 21, 2025. The quarter saw an expansion in net interest margin by eight basis points, attributed to growth in net loans and deposits, and a decrease in the cost of funds. Despite fluctuations in US Treasury rates, Kearny Financial remains confident in its core business performance. The company’s total assets increased slightly to $7.73 billion, with notable growth in loans receivable and deposits. However, non-interest income decreased due to lower gains on loan sales and electronic banking fees. Non-interest expenses rose due to increased salaries, benefits, and advertising costs. The company’s asset quality remained stable, with non-performing assets steady at $37.7 million.

More about Kearny Financial
Kearny Financial Corp. is a financial services company operating as the holding company for Kearny Bank. The company primarily focuses on providing banking services, including loans and deposits, with a market emphasis on non-residential mortgage loans and consumer savings deposits.
